May Day, Chagford


Happy May Day, everyone. Alas, out here in Devon and Cornwall all the usual May Day festivities have been cancelled due to the Covid-19 lockdown. There's no Obby Oss on the streets of Padstow, no Border Morris dancers bringing the sun up on Dartmoor, no maypoles, no lusty Jack-in-the-Greens. How will the seasons turn without them?


Tilly and I had our own private ceremony this morning, blessing the green in our own quiet way -- and we send that blessing from Dartmoor to each of you. Up the May!


Beltane Fire


The images above are from previous May Days: Howard dancing the Obby Oss down the high street of Chagford, with a Jack-in-Green close behind; and dancing the willow frame of the Jack around a Beltane fire. (To see more photos, go here.) 


The art below is from village neighbours: Moor Maiden by Virginia Lee and two Green Women by Brian Froud. Despite the lockdown and physical distancing, we are still a community. We are dancing in spirit.
